Lauren R. Shaw was born on April 2, 1946, in Atlanta, Georgia, United States.
Lauren Shaw earned a Bachelor of Visual Arts from Georgia State University, Atlanta (1968). She received her Master of Fine Arts in photography from the Rhode Island School of Design where she studied with Harry Callahan and Aaron Siskind.
Since 1972 Lauren Shaw has been an assistant professor of fine arts at Emerson College, Boston, and since 1977 has lectured at Essex Workshop in Essex, Massachusetts. She served on the staff of Apeiron Workshops in Millerton, New York, from 1974 to 1976.
Lauren Shaw is a tenured Professor at Emerson College, Department of Visual and Media Arts. Co-founder of New England Women in Photography and Co-chaired the National Conference in 1997.
Lauren Shaw continues to exhibit her latest photographic work: “Maps,” and was selected for Southeast Center for Photography: Portrait Show, 2019, Greenville, SC, LA Artcore, Photographic Exhibition and Competition, 2019, Honorable Mention, and Exposure, 2018, Juried Exhibition, Photographic Resource Center, Boston.
